OBJECTIVE: To evaluate the effect of postpolymerization treatment based on ethanol-aqueous solutions on the residual monomer (RM) content, flexural strength, microhardness, and cytotoxicity of hard chairside reline resins (Kooliner, Ufi Gel Hard).Entities:

Mean (×104 µg/g) and SD of RM content of experimental groups from material Kooliner (n = 6) and Ufi Gel Hard (n = 6).
| Material | Temp. | Dry conditions | Type of solution | |||
|---|---|---|---|---|---|---|
| Water | Ethanol 20% | Ethanol 50% | Ethanol 70% | |||
| Kooliner | 23 ± 2°C | 2.77 (0.29)aA | 2.51 (0.16)aA | 2.56 (0.25)aA | 2.57 (0.31)aA | 2.46 (0.41)aA |
| 55 ± 2°C | 2.67 (0.22)aA | 2.04 (0.21)bB | 1.88 (0.15)bB | 1.59 (0.14)cB | 0.80 (0.16)dB | |
|
| ||||||
| Ufi Gel Hard | 23 ± 2°C | 1.90 (0.15)aA | 1.62 (0.26)bA | 1.58 (0.17)bA | 1.52 (0.23)bA | 1.45 (0.11)bA |
| 55 ± 2°C | 1.85 (0.32)aA | 0.95 (0.05)bB | 0.86 (0.42)cB | 0.72 (0.13)dB | 0.39 (0.05)eB | |
Horizontally identical superscripted small letters denote no significant differences among groups (P > 0.05).
Vertically identical superscripted capital letters denote no significant differences among groups (P > 0.05).
